Output cf51890fa775b9ab6f40789a8832fab56dcf15b19f2a1e06c3ed5c2d83eacc97:3

value
10098909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da4ca3466893271a99c17e68800e5671fd56047 OP_EQUAL
address
3Mtxfjnyb3qU6UdMu5UHs5Ws37nJD6AiG5
transaction
cf51890fa775b9ab6f40789a8832fab56dcf15b19f2a1e06c3ed5c2d83eacc97
spent
true